When you trade crypto without a middleman, you’re using a ProtonSwap, a decentralized exchange built on the Proton blockchain that lets users swap tokens directly from their wallets with near-zero fees and instant settlement. Also known as Proton DEX, it’s one of the few platforms where trading feels as simple as sending a text message—no complex approvals, no long waits, no hidden costs.
ProtonSwap isn’t just another DeFi platform. It’s built on the Proton blockchain, a high-performance, energy-efficient layer-1 network optimized for real-world financial use cases like payments, trading, and identity. This means trades happen in under a second, and gas fees are practically nonexistent. Unlike Ethereum-based DEXs that struggle with congestion, ProtonSwap moves like a well-oiled machine. It’s the kind of system that makes DeFi feel usable again—not just for crypto natives, but for anyone who’s tired of paying $50 in fees to swap $100 worth of tokens.
What makes ProtonSwap stand out isn’t just speed or cost—it’s how it connects to real identity. The Proton network lets users link verified digital identities to their wallets. That means you can trade tokens, lend, or stake without giving up privacy, but still have a clear, trustworthy trail if needed. This blend of anonymity and accountability is rare. It’s why institutions and everyday users alike are starting to pay attention. ProtonSwap isn’t trying to replace Uniswap or SushiSwap. It’s offering something different: a clean, fast, identity-aware trading experience that doesn’t ask you to choose between security and simplicity.
Related tools like non-custodial wallets, such as those used to hold Proton tokens without relying on exchanges, are essential here. You don’t need to deposit funds anywhere—you just connect your wallet and swap. And because the Proton chain supports fiat on-ramps and stablecoin integrations, you can move between crypto and traditional money more smoothly than on most other chains.
